Can I charge my Ford at a Tesla station?

Tesla has its own proprietary plug no other automaker uses and its own network of chargers. Ford uses a J1772 plug – a common design used by many non-Tesla EVs. It's compatible with most non-Tesla charging stations. Teslas come with an adapter that allows them to charge at other charging stations.

Can you charge a BMW X5 with a Tesla charger?

You are right that Tesla funded the stations. Unfortunately the Tesla superchargers are Level 3 chargers(400v DC) and the X5 has no provision for any type of Level 3 charging. So there is no way an adapter could be made to charge the X5 off a Tesla Supercharger.

What is a Level 2 charger?

Standard public Level 2 charger

Summary: L2 chargers operate at 208-240 V and output anywhere from 3 kW to 19 kW of AC power. This power output translates to 18-28 miles of range per hour. An average EV can be fully charged in 8 hours or less.

Can I use Tesla Supercharger without app?

No separate RFID card or smartphone app is required to access Tesla Supercharger or Destination points. The units communicate with the car to ensure the vehicle is a Tesla, before commencing the charging process. Costs are charged to an account linked to the car.
